Hans Diehl, DrHSc, MPH• Worked with Nathan Pritikin
Longevity Center, a pioneer lifestyle health center as NIH research fellow
• Made lifestyle medicine his life work and career, developing community programs
• Conducted programs in US, Canada, India, Australia with hundreds attending
• Eventually produced videos of program

Advantages of Community-based Program• Pritikin program is residential - requires
folks to travel across country or world• Costs thousands ($5,000 - $20,000)• Requires leaving home environment
and being off work• Return to same environment after
program with no support• Difficult to continue the lifestyle
changes
Jan 2010 Lifestyle Health Education, Inc. 14
Advantages of Community-based Program• Community-based program lets you
stay at home - no long travel required• Can implement lifestyle changes in
your own kitchen and dining room• Local alumni group gives support• Results are comparable to residential• Costs far less (Only $495 for a year
instead of $10-20,000 for 2-3 weeks)$295

Overview of CHIP Program• Heart screen with fasting blood testing• Three evenings a week for five+ weeks
(16 evenings, Mon, Tue & Thur 6:30-8:45pm)
• DVD lectures plus group medical visits with live presentations
• Cooking classes and taste samples• Exercise activity and Grocery store tour• Second heart screen with blood tests• Grad banquet, certificates and awards
